Mission

United Way of Mahaska County empowers our communities by promoting education, encouraging healthy living, and strengthening financial stability.

Take-Along Food Program: United Way of Mahaska County's Take-Along Weekend Food Program provides bags of meals, snacks, and drinks to students who struggle with food insecurity over the weekend. Each Friday during the school year, the program served approximately 168 students at Oskaloosa Elementary School, Oskaloosa Middle School, Eddyville Elementary School, and Fremont Elementary School.

Back to School Fair: Each summer United Way of Mahaska County sponsors a school supply drive, collecting school supplies and accepting donations for the purchase of backpacks and supplies. Any child or youth (preschool through 12th grade) residing in Mahaska County is eligible to receive a filled backpack through this program. In 2024, a drive-thru Back to School Fair was organized to distribute the backpacks, as well as offer shoes and socks. Agencies that offer programming for youth were able to submit information about their activities for inclusion in the backpacks. Approximately 400 backpacks were distributed to families in need. Some of the leftover school supplies were given to local schools to stock school supply closets, which teachers can utilize throughout the year. We partnered with Mahaska YMCA, Soles 4 Souls, and the school districts in Mahaska County.

Volunteer Mahaska: United Way of Mahaska County operates a Volunteer Center in Mahaska County. Local agencies are able to post volunteer needs on the Volunteer Mahaska website. Community members can access the website to find volunteer opportunities that match their interests and availability. The Volunteer Center coordinated many volunteers for the Oskaloosa Summer Lunch Program in 2024.

VITA Tax Site: United Way of Mahaska County recruits volunteers, coordinates and hosts a VITA Tax Preparation Assistance Site. IRS Certified Volunteer Tax Preparers provide free tax preparation for seniors and low-income families and individuals.

Days Of Caring: United Way of Mahaska County empowers volunteers in our community to come together to assist in completing a variety of projects each year, including those that serve seniors and individuals with disabilities, city and council projects, local non-profit agencies, and schools. In 2024, we completed 29 projects with approximately 147 volunteers.

Winter Coat Drive: United Way of Mahaska County coordinated a local Coat Drive. Volunteers provided manpower for distribution of collection boxes and regularly collected coats and other winter outerwear items. Of these items, many were given to local schools. A distribution event was held at Penn Central Mall to distribute the remaining items to the public at no charge.
